The global wireline logging service market was valued at USD 19 billion in 2024 and is estimated to grow at a CAGR of 5.4% from 2025 to 2034. on account of increasing investments in mineral, and oil & gas resource exploration along with ongoing R&D initiatives toward well intervention techniques. Consistent oil demand and rising investments in energy coupled with ongoing well infrastructure development across several regions will drive the industry growth.
The increasing energy demand and initiatives for redeveloping wells in mature oil fields is further complementing the business landscape. For instance, in March 2023, In the Adriatic Sea, Halliburton Europe performed wireline services for INA Group's offshore operations. The team conducted logging operations on four wells through 17 successful runs, maintaining safety standards throughout the 272-hour project duration. The efficient execution allowed INA to assess well data in real time, while the implemented measurement workflow revealed additional hydrocarbon zones in offshore Croatia.

The e-line segment is anticipated to cross USD 16 billion by 2034. E-line systems incorporate specialized electric cables with steel armor to enable data transmission in wells, featuring different conductor configurations and durability levels for wireline operations further augmenting the service deployment. The technology allows surface monitoring of well conditions, including reservoir parameters, tubing status, and cement bond measurements together with through continuous data collection and transmission, it helps operators improve well monitoring and maintenance procedures, contributing to industry growth.
The cased hole segment is set to experience a growth rate of over 5% through 2034, driven by rising well intervention requirements and technological improvements in monitoring systems. These services involve collecting precise measurements through specialized metal piping and well casings during completion procedures. The process enables operators to gather critical data about wellbore conditions, formation properties, and reservoir characteristics, helping optimize production performance and ensure well integrity throughout the operational lifecycle.
The U.S. wireline logging service market is set to cross over USD 8.5 billion by 2034. Increasing oil and gas exploration activities, favorable government policies coupled with rising investments in advanced technologies, are driving the industry growth. The growing number of onshore and offshore wells, along with expanding shale gas operations that has led companies to focus on improving efficiency and productivity through digital services and process optimization.
The expansion of exploration and production activities in shale reservoirs, combined with the growth oil production and consumption across various sectors has positively influenced the business dynamics, further complementing the business landscape. For instance, as per the U.S. EIA, in March 2024, crude oil production across the nation reached an average of 13.3 million barrels per day in December 2023, driven by increased productivity from new wells. After breaking the previous record in August 2023, U.S. crude oil production grew by an additional 2%, surpassing the pre-pandemic November 2019 peak by 0.3 million b/d.
